Über dieses Spiel
Aegis is a 2D mech action shooter where you play as the last defender for a small settlement. Through exploring the frozen wasteland, you will gather vital resources to help your people build the Atmospheric Cleansing Unit, battle hostile scavengers, and find new parts to upgrade your ATEX Battlesuit.
- Modular Mechs – Customize your ATEX Battlesuit to fit your playstyle.
- Diversely Equipped Enemies – You’re not the only one with the ability to customize.
- Scavenging – Venture out to find resources and parts for the Atmospheric Cleansing Unit that is being constructed by your settlement.
- Assault Bases – Find essential construction parts, rare items, and powerful weaponry by attacking enemy bases.
- Armour Penetration System – Watch as low powered weaponry bounces off your thick armour harmlessly.
- Diverse Item Selection – Many different items and weapons drastically change the performance of your ATEX Battlesuit.
Soundtrack composed by Jim Hall.
